The Old Mill, Holywood: A Historical and Artistic Perspective (1834) This exquisite pencil and watercolor drawing, titled "The Old Mill, Holywood," is an enchanting glimpse into the past, created by the skilled hand of Andrew Nicholl in 1834. The Old Mill, located in Holywood, County Down, Northern Ireland, has been a cherished landmark for centuries, and Nicholl's masterful depiction captures its timeless beauty and historical significance. Andrew Nicholl (1804-1886) was an accomplished Irish artist, known for his meticulous attention to detail and his ability to capture the essence of his subjects. In this drawing, he expertly portrays the Old Mill as it stood in the early 19th century, with its weathered stone walls, intricate wooden gears, and the gentle flow of the River Quoile nearby. The mill, which dates back to at least the 17th century, was a vital part of the local community, providing essential services such as grain grinding and flour milling.
